It’s been an action-packed first two levels at this final table. Within the first 10 hands, there were three called all-ins, and every time, a player doubled up. It hasn’t happened again since then. On the 13th hand of the day, Corey Hochman was eliminated in 10th place, and five other players followed him out the door: John Holley, Joseph Alesna, Tai Cao, Tony Sanchez, and John Lauve.
